Since the first works introducing the aluminum intercalated clay
family in the early 1970s, interest in the synthesis of pillared
interlayered clays has increased tremendously, especially research
into the properties and applications of new synthesis methods. The
need for solids that could be used as cracking catalysts with
larger pores than zeolitic materials has spurred the synthesis of
new porous materials from clays. Pillared Clays and Related
Catalysts reviews the properties and applications of pillared clays
and other layered materials used as catalysts, focusing on: the
acidity of pillared clays and the effect it has on catalytic
performance the use of pillared clays as supports for catalytically
active phases, and the use of the resulting solids in
environmentally friendly reactions the applications of the
selective reduction of NOx the comparison between the reactions of
pillared clays and anionic clays.
